JessicaEby - April 8, 2007 03:32 AM (GMT)
What is a tell-a-friend referral? I just updated some stats on my profile and noticed that it says "tell-a-friend referrals: 1 all-time, 1 during the last seven days" new-member referrals are when someone joins after you telling them about it, or them finding one of your books or whatever and listing you as the member who referred them, right? And if so, what is a tell-a-friend referral? This is probably something really obvious, but... you never know unless you ask!

EllyMae58 - April 8, 2007 03:43 AM (GMT)
I used to think the "tell-a-friend" was when you filled out the little email thingy to "tell a friend" about BC. But it's that, PLUS anywhere you might have a referral link to BC, like on a blog or a webpage or in an email signature etc.

PepperVL - April 8, 2007 01:28 PM (GMT)
You don't have to have sent out any emails. If you put a link that says
CODE
http://www.bookcrossing.com/friend/peppervl

or
CODE
http://www.bookcrossing.com/referral/peppervl

anywhere on the web - in your blog, in your signature here, in an automatic email signature, on your web page, etc. and someone not logged in to BC clicks on it, your tell a friend referrals go up.

CheriePie - April 9, 2007 07:01 PM (GMT)
Since I just got my stats done from that guy in Germany, I was playing with them last night, and I noticed that the names that are listed at the bottom, in the two screennames section, when you click on them, it brings you to their bookshelf using the Referral link, i.e. http://www.bookcrossing.com/mybookshelf/ne...zoloft/referral

So most likely all of us getting Stats pages done, and clicking on names from those Stats, is causing the jump in those tell-a-friend referral numbers! user posted image
